Motor power

The motor of the treadmill is a significant aspect to take into consideration. They are costly and you want one that lasts. The continuous horsepower (CHP) rating is a reliable indicator of the power the treadmill's motor can sustain for a long time without overheating or wearing out very quickly. The greater the CHP rating is, the more powerful the treadmill's motor.

The treadmill's thrust rating is an additional important factor to consider. This number indicates how much the motor can support and the weight of the person who is using it. If you plan to make use of your treadmill as a high-intensity exercise machine you'll need a treadmill that has greater thrust ratings.

Incline options

A treadmill with incline options is a great way to intensify your exercise. By increasing the incline, you can simulate running or walking uphill that engages various muscles and boosts the intensity of your workout. Additionally, incline-training helps you build leg strength and improve balance. The best incline for you will depend on the fitness goals you've set. In general the higher the incline, the more effective.
